🎓 Overview of Jobs at Nile Higher Institute For Science

The Nile Higher Institute For Science, located in the vibrant Dakahlia Governorate of Egypt, stands as a beacon for academic excellence in the Nile Delta region. Established to meet the growing demand for qualified professionals in science and technology fields, this private higher education institution offers a range of job opportunities for educators, researchers, and administrators. Jobs at Nile Higher Institute For Science typically encompass faculty positions such as lecturers and assistant professors, research assistants, and support staff in areas like computer science, information systems, and business administration. These roles contribute to the institute's mission of delivering high-quality education aligned with Egypt's Vision 2030 for sustainable development.

In the context of Egypt's expanding higher education sector, where private institutes like Nile Higher Institute play a crucial role in bridging skill gaps, employment here means engaging with a diverse student body from across Africa. Whether you're a PhD holder seeking to advance research or a master's graduate aiming to teach, understanding the landscape of jobs at Nile Higher Institute For Science is essential for career planning. The institute emphasizes practical training, making positions ideal for those passionate about applied sciences.

History and Growth of Nile Higher Institute For Science

Founded in the early 2000s amid Egypt's push for private higher education, Nile Higher Institute For Science began as a modest facility in Mansoura, quickly expanding to offer accredited bachelor's programs. By 2010, it had established key departments in computing and engineering, responding to national needs for tech-savvy graduates. Today, with over 5,000 students, the institute has grown into a respected name, boasting modern laboratories and partnerships with local industries. This evolution has created steady demand for jobs at Nile Higher Institute For Science, particularly as enrollment rises due to affordable tuition and proximity to Cairo.

The institute's history reflects broader trends in African higher education, where institutions adapt to technological shifts. Faculty who join contribute to milestones like the launch of AI-focused curricula in 2022, enhancing Egypt's digital economy contributions.

🔬 Required Academic Qualifications, Research Focus, Experience, and Skills

To secure jobs at Nile Higher Institute For Science, candidates need targeted qualifications. For faculty roles like professor or associate professor, a PhD (Doctor of Philosophy, the highest academic degree signifying original research contribution) in the relevant field is mandatory. Lecturers typically hold a master's degree with strong academic records.

Research focus centers on applied sciences: publications in journals indexed by Scopus or Web of Science are prized, alongside expertise in AI, data science, and renewable energy—areas vital to Egypt's economy. Preferred experience includes 3-5 years of teaching, supervising theses, or securing grants from bodies like the Science and Technology Development Fund (STDF).

  • Publications: At least 5 peer-reviewed papers.
  • Grants: Experience with national funding enhances applications.
  • Teaching: Proven record in large classes common in Egyptian institutes.

Essential skills and competencies encompass communication for lectures, proficiency in tools like MATLAB or Python, and soft skills like teamwork. For admin roles, HR (Human Resources) experience or financial management is key.

Diversity and Inclusion Initiatives

Nile Higher Institute For Science actively promotes diversity, with initiatives like the Women in STEM program launched in 2019, offering mentorship and scholarships to female faculty and students. Over 40% of new hires in 2023 were women, surpassing national averages. The institute partners with Egypt's National Council for Women, hosting workshops on inclusive teaching. International faculty from Sudan and other African nations enrich the community, fostering cross-cultural research. These efforts align with global standards, making it welcoming for diverse candidates.

⚖️ Work-Life Balance and Campus Life

Campus life at Nile Higher Institute For Science in Mansoura blends academics with Delta culture. The modern campus includes air-conditioned classrooms, advanced labs, sports facilities, and a library with digital resources. Faculty enjoy flexible schedules—typically 20 teaching hours weekly—allowing research time. Benefits cover health insurance, annual leave, and professional development funds.

Mansoura's location offers Nile River proximity for relaxation, local markets, and festivals like Mansoura National Festival. Work-life balance is supported by no mandatory overtime and family-friendly policies, including childcare support. Employees often join cultural clubs, enhancing community ties in this family-oriented Egyptian setting.
